view more2023418 · Silica sand is a type of sand that contains a high proportion of silica, which is a naturally occurring mineral that is essential for many industrial and commercial applications. silica sand is made of silicon dioxide (SiO2) and may also contain small amounts of iron, aluminum, and other trace elements.
